Abstract
Two cases of impending gastric rupture, associated with malrotation and midgut volvulus, are reported. The diverticulous mucosal protrusions were characteristically revealed as a box-shaped gastric shadow in the plain X-ray and upper GI series. Two cases were operatively treated with only the seromuscular suture of the defect without excision of the mucosal protrusion. Midgut volvulus and malrotation were reduced.
